LIE NUMBER ONE: “Your Bible has 73 books. The Catholics had it first.”

It does not. They did not.

The 1611 King James Bible included the Apocrypha. Open any photographic reprint. Tobit. Judith. Wisdom. Sirach. Baruch. The translators put it between Malachi and Matthew as historical reading.

Not as Scripture.

They said so in the preface. They named it. They quoted Jerome. They quoted Athanasius. They knew the difference between what the Holy Ghost preserved and what the Jews stored on the same shelf for context.

The Roman Catholic Church added the Apocrypha to her official canon at the Council of Trent. The year was 1546. Fifteen hundred years after the cross.

Read that date again.

Trent was a reaction to the Reformation. Rome dogmatized seven extra books because the Reformers were beating her with the books she already had. The Apocrypha got promoted to defend Purgatory, prayers for the dead, and salvation by works.

That is not the original Bible.

That is damage control.

LIE NUMBER THREE: “Men chose your Bible. Constantine voted on it.”

Constantine did not vote on a single book of your Bible.

The Council of Nicaea, 325 AD, dealt with the deity of Christ. Read the proceedings. There is no canon discussion on the agenda.

Athanasius wrote his Festal Letter in 367 AD. He listed twenty-seven New Testament books. The same twenty-seven you have. He did not invent them. He did not put them to a vote. He recognized what the church had already been reading, copying, and dying for.

The Synod of Hippo, 393 AD, and the Council of Carthage, 397 AD, affirmed what was already in use. They did not select. They confirmed.

Recognition is not selection.

“All scripture is given by inspiration of God.” 2 Timothy 3:16. Inspired before any council met. Inspired before any vote was taken. Inspired before any printing press existed.

Tyndale did not burn because a council picked his books. Tyndale burned because the books were already God’s, and Rome wanted to control who could read them. The fire was about access. Not about canon.
